Historically, weight loss medications relied on central nervous system stimulants like phentermine, which carried significant cardiovascular risks, sleep disruption, and high rates of rebound weight gain once stopped
GLP-1 receptor agonists like semaglutide and liraglutide, and dual GIP/GLP-1 receptor agonists like tirzepatide, slow gastric emptying, reduce appetite, and improve insulin sensitivity
